The SysMaster NC 9000 is an integrated solution
for the Web. It represents a HAHD (High Availability High Density)
and cost-effective server platform designed to run mission critical
applications in ultra-dense computing environments. The SysMaster
NC 9000 offers high availability, scalability and performance due
to its proprietary loadbalancing built-in technology. High-density
is pushed to the limit with a single set of peripheral devices (CD-ROM
drive, FDD drive, keyboard, video display, and mouse) shared by
all the systems within the rack.
SysMaster NC 9000 is a rackmount
platform whose backplane offers 10 slots for 3U CPU boards. The
integrated backplane supports hot swap. Hence, the system boards
are hot swappable to simplify replacement and minimize service time.

SysMaster NC 9000 is housed
in a 3U 19-inch rack-mountable enclosure. Adapters for mounting
in a 23-inch rack are provided.
The SysMaster NC 9000 Intelligent KVM switching
board allows access to multiple servers in order to update, maintain,
or address server-related issues using one single set of CD-R drive,
FDD drive, keyboard, and mouse. Daisy chaining of the SysMaster
NC 9000 systems frees up more space and allows data centers to cram
more computing horsepower in the same square footage.
The SysMaster NC 9000 system provides up to 10 system
slots. At least 9 slots are dedicated to individual servers. The
"bladed" design of vertically inserting multiple single-board servers
into a single enclosure creates a lot of density per U. A 42U rack
of SysMaster NC 9000 systems, therefore, is capable of holding up
to 140 servers.

High-volume web sites usually consist of
multiple servers or server clusters providing the same service from
synchronized contents. With the SysMaster NC 9000 all these servers
are addressed from the Internet using a single Virtual IP address.
SysMaster loadbalances the traffic for this IP among the servers
based upon the workload, and the processing capabilities of the
individual servers. SysMaster uses both static and dynamic algorithms
for optimized loadbalancing.
Direct Path Routing

Network Address Translation

Direct-Path Routing mode for High Speed
loadbalancing
SysMaster takes into account the individual capabilities of every
server. This allows administrators to put servers with varying
capabilities in one cluster thus obtaining optimum performance
and high utilization of the available resources along with investment
costs reduction. To increase the overall throughput of the server
cluster, the SysMaster NC 9000 implements the Direct-Path Routing
technique allowing servers to send responses directly to the clients
without passing traffic through the loadbalancing device.
NAT loadbalancing
The great advantage of NAT is that real servers can run any OS
that supports TCP/IP protocol. The only requirement for the real
servers is that they should use SysMaster as their default gateway.
Another advantage is that real servers use private IP addresses
and ports, which increases security and conserves real IP addresses.

SysMaster NC 9000 as a Gateway in NAT mode
SysMaster NC 9000 connects local corporate networks to the Internet.
Corporate computers have private IP addresses and are not directly
accessible from the global network. LAN users access the Internet
through SysMaster NC 9000. SysMaster rewrites packets as they pass
through it, so that they always seem to come from the device itself.
It then rewrites the responses so that they can reach the original
recipient.
SysMaster allows for all managed servers to be visible
via a Virtual IP, and on specified ports that can be easily enabled
and filtered, resulting in enhanced security.
In Network Address Translation mode, well-known
ports such as 80, 443, 20, and 21 can be mapped to any port number
on the actual servers. This provides greater security by making
it difficult for intruders to identify what services are running
on which port.
